*A lawsuit was filed alleging that since the start of military operations in Iraq and Afghanistan, the Navy and Marine Corps discharged thousands of Sailors and Marines with Other Than Honorable ("OTH") or General (Under Honorable Conditions) ("GEN") statuses due to misconduct attributable to post-traumatic stress disorder ("PTSD"), traumatic brain injury ("TBI"), military sexual trauma ("MST"), and other behavioral health conditions ("OBH"). Furthermore, the lawsuit alleges that veterans who experienced PTSD, TBI, MST, or OBH in service and received OTH and GEN discharges were systematically denied status upgrades by the Navy Discharge Review Board ("NDRB"). The Navy has agreed to settle the lawsuit while denying these allegations. The Court certified a class in this civil action (the “Settlement Class”) defined as follows: "Veterans who served during the Iraq and Afghanistan Era—defined as the period between October 7, 2001 and February 15, 2022—who: were discharged from the Navy, Navy Reserves, Marine Corps, or Marine Corps Reserve with less-than-Honorable statuses, including General and Other-than-Honorable discharges but excluding Bad Conduct or Dishonorable discharges; have not received upgrades of their discharge statuses to Honorable from the NDRB; and have diagnoses of PTSD, TBI, or other related mental health conditions, or records documenting one or more symptoms of PTSD, TBI, or other related mental health conditions at the time of discharge, attributable to their military service under the Hagel Memo standards of liberal or special consideration.” *verbatim text from https://www.mankersettlement.com/ Review the website above for more information --- Send in a voice message: https://anchor.fm/ferah-ozbek/message

Diversity and inclusion are important in sales but what do these things mean exactly? In today's episode, Stephen Hart and Sharon Manker are joining Donald in talking about what diversity and inclusion mean in sales. Diversity and inclusion in sales Diversity is being invited to the table and inclusion means having a seat at the table to participate in whatever opportunity there is. It's not just about getting the seat at the table but it's also about having the equity component. We need to break down the unconscious biases that we have. We need to employ true diversity, equity, and inclusion not only in the sales team but also in an organization as a whole. For the black men and women, what the media portrays of us doesn't really represent who we are. Growing up, you may have developed a certain mindset towards people of color and that translates into the workplace. Naturally, you gravitate towards the things that you know and what you've been taught. There are biases that we were brought up with that we need to check at the door. Getting over the things that you've been taught is an uncomfortable conversation. There's a need for willingness and openness to have these difficult conversations. There are things that you can do to change the cycle and have more diversity and inclusion in your organization even if you're only a small group. Shaping the culture Culture is very important. Sharon's organization is very committed to the culture of inclusion and diversity. They recently hired a Chief Diversity Officer, an initiative that highlights the differences. There's self-reporting that employees can do. You can go and report that you're an LGBTQ without any repercussions. You need to be comfortable in the skin that you're in when you go to work. Organizations should encourage people to have difficult conversations to ensure that the culture is sustainable. It needs a top-down approach where people at the top invite everyone to be heard. The goal is to create an environment in the workplace where everyone can talk about the biases and differences. Every member of the organization should be able to see each other and be able to show empathy. Organizations should champion training everyone on unconscious biases, on how to talk about difficult conversations, and how to be advocates. Expanding the workforce for people of color At the end of the day, you're going to hire the most suitable person for the role. But it's also important that organizations represent society and have different perspectives in the team. If everyone is looking through one lens, then you're missing an opportunity. The more you know, the more you grow. In sales, the more you know of the things that you're trying to achieve, the more likely you'll get success. Unless you have a diversity of thoughts in the team, you won't have innovation. Unless you are inclusive, you won't know what else is out there. “Diversity: What Do Diversity and Inclusion Mean in Sales?” episode resources Connect with Sharon Manker on LinkedIn. Wie viel Ausbeutung und Quälereien braucht die hohe Kunst? Und braucht sie das Leiden wirklich? Die Vorwürfe gegen den umstrittenen Theatermacher Paulus Manker führen zu Grundsatzfragen des Schauspielbetriebs.Paulus Manker ist ein rühriger Theatermann im deutschen Sprachraum. Zu sehen war der Sohn des ehemaligen Volkstheaterdirektors Gustav Manker und der Schauspielerin Hilde Sochor im Deutschen Schauspielhaus in Hamburg, im Wiener Burgtheater und bei den Salzburger Festspielen, ebenso inszeniert er unter anderem an Burg- und Volkstheater. Manker hat Filme gemacht und sich einst vor Gericht mit Jörg Haider angelegt. Berühmt wurde er Mitte der 1990er Jahre mit seinem Stationendrama „Alma“, mit dem er seither tourt. 2018 brachte er in einem über siebenstündigen Spektakel „Die letzten Tage der Menschheit“ von Karl Kraus auf die Bühne. Das Stück wird aktuell in Wien aufgeführt.Manker gilt als Berserker und Enfant Terrible der Theaterwelt. In den letzten Wochen haben ehemalige Mitarbeiterinnen und Mitarbeiter schwere Vorwürfe gegen den Theatermacher erhoben. Von Beschimpfungen, Demütigungen, gesundheitlicher Gefährdung, physischer Gewalt und arbeitsrechtlich fragwürdigen Verträgen ist die Rede. Es ist eine Kritik, die über den Einzelfall hinaus geht. Was bedeutet es, für Paulus Manker zu arbeiten? Und braucht Kunst wirklich Ausbeutung, um gut zu sein? Being honorably discharged from the military is the reality most veterans face. They receive all benefits from their time in service and help from the VA with healthcare and other […]
Being honorably discharged from the military is the reality most veterans face. They receive all benefits from their time in service and help from the VA with healthcare and other significant issues. To me, it’s always been a given. I served my country and for that, I receive these services. But what if you had to leave the military and receive NONE of those benefits? This would make sense if someone was court martialed or committed a high offense in some way during their service, but how about someone who doesn’t? Would it make sense to give a lifetime of punishment to a person who commits a minor offense and yet loses all access to assistance from the VA and otherwise? Here is my interview with Tyson Manker, Marine Corps combat veteran who participated in the invasion of Iraq during Operation Iraqi Freedom and following his deployment, he smoked weed in an attempt to deal with PTSD symptoms that he didn’t even recognize yet. In return, he was chaptered from the USMC and received a less than honorable discharge. Here is his story. Extreme Genes - America's Family History and Genealogy Radio Show & Podcast
America might have been more like Australia than you think. This week, researcher Peggy Lauritzen explains how America also indulged in white slavery! Then, Kathy Manker of Phoenix, AZ talks about her "black sheep" 19th century ancestor.Fisher opens the show with David Allen Lambert, Chief Genealogist for the New England Historic Genealogical Society and AmericanAncestors.com. With Fisher's Mets defeating the Cubs to go to the World Series, David shares a database for researching baseball players from the recent and distant past. David also talks about an amazing find he has made for the 170th anniversary of NEHGS... a family tie between author Nathaniel Philbrick (who will be honored in Boston for the celebration) and author Herman Melville, both of whom have researched the story that resulted in "Moby Dick." In Family Histoire news, David talks about a 450-year-old Mexican colonial church that has been revealed by the drying up of a reservoir due to the current drought. It's a fabulous image! Fisher and David then discuss a 100-year-old woman in Buffalo, New York, who still works six days a week, eleven hours a day... and loves it. She's been working since 1930! David then talks about the ongoing archaeological dig at the Boston Common that has revealed items from a Revolutionary era encampment. He then shares his "Tech Tip," and another free database of the week from NEHGS.In segment two, Fisher visits with researcher Peggy Lauritzen who explains the particulars of pre-colonial white slavery in America. She explains the various types, from apprentices to indentured servants, and the way many ended up in their situations. Peggy claims America was a penal colony long before Australia! It's a revealing discussion you won't want to miss.Fisher then talks to Kathy Manker of Phoenix, AZ. Kathy and her clan dug up some amazing dirt on a third great grandfather and his family from the late 1800s in Illinois. It sounds a lot like the wild west! You'll be amazed at what she has found.Fisher and Tom Perry then talk about creating a special box you can use to take digital copies of your antique photographs. It's cheap and fun!That's all this week on Extreme Genes, America's Family History Show!
